This red fruited, heritage variety, widely planted as early as the 1890's, is a highly flavored, dessert quality variety which can be eaten out of hand. The smallish berries are sweet, aromatic, and have tough, smooth skins which offer the delightfully distinctive "pop" texture of a good gooseberry when eaten. Yields of 5+ pounds per plant over a long
